IP Country City ISP
185.149.91.37 Netherlands Rotterdam Rapiddot Hosting Services Ltd
46.166.191.28 Netherlands NFOrce Entertainment B.V.
85.17.170.48 Netherlands LeaseWeb Netherlands B.V.